The symposium on “Mining  Engineering and Geo-Resources” will be held in the scope of the 3rd Doctoral Congress Engineering (DCE19) which will be hosted at FEUP, Porto, Portugal on the 27th and 28th of June 2019.

Symposium Comittee is pleased to invite you to share ongoing work or results of PhD or Master.

Topics for submission will focus on:

  • Mining Extraction
  • Mineral Processing
  • Environmental Mining Impact
  • Mineral Exploration and Feasibility
  • Mining Life Assessment  (including: Resources Assessment, Mining Planning, Mine Closure, Recycling, Life Cycle Assessment, Occupational Assessment, etc.)
